Description
Key features of the PMEG4005AEA include a low forward voltage drop, which reduces energy loss during the rectification process, and fast reverse recovery time, which is crucial for high-frequency applications. These characteristics make it suitable for use in various electronic devices, such as smartphones, tablets, and other portable gadgets, where power efficiency and thermal management are critical.
The PMEG4005AEA is typically utilized in DC-DC converters, power supplies, and other applications requiring efficient rectification. Its compact size and efficiency make it an ideal choice for modern electronic design where space and energy efficiency are paramount.

Features
1. Low Forward Voltage Drop: This characteristic enables efficient operation and reduced power loss, making it suitable for low voltage applications.
2. High Surge Current Capability: The diode can handle higher surge currents, providing reliability in dynamic load conditions and transient environments.
3. Compact Package: It is housed in a small, flat-lead surface-mounted package, often a SOD-323 or equivalent, which saves space on PCB designs.
4. Low Reverse Current: It has a low reverse current leakage, which enhances efficiency and performance in reverse bias conditions.
5. Temperature Stability: The diode offers reliable performance across a range of temperatures, ensuring longevity and consistent operation in various environments.
These features make the PMEG4005AEA ideal for applications in power management, automotive systems, and other low-voltage designs where efficiency and space-saving are crucial.
Pinout
- Pin Count: 2 pins
- Function:
- Anode (Pin 1): This is the positive side of the diode, where current flows into the diode.
- Cathode (Pin 2): This is the negative side of the diode, where current flows out of the diode.
The primary function of the PMEG4005AEA is to allow current to pass in one direction (from anode to cathode) while blocking it in the reverse direction, making it ideal for rectification and protection applications. Its Schottky barrier design enables fast switching and low forward voltage drop, which enhances efficiency in power-sensitive applications.
